**TICKET-442: ChipGate reader env pointing at staging**

Heads up, future maintainers: the ChipGate timing-chip reader at the Lundqvist Harbor Marathon was posting split times to staging because someone copied the wrong env file onto the trackside box. Runners' splits vanished for ~40 minutes. Fix is to set the ingest URL to prod in `/etc/chipgate/reader.env` and restart the daemon. While you're in there, the reader also needs its upload credential on the next line.

env line for bagug-bagap: COURIER_KEY3=920

Handover: Lintharbor baseline file

Hi Mira — the static-analysis baseline for the Copperfen repo was regenerated today, so older suppressed findings are gone and anything new will fail CI honestly. If on-call sees a surprise pipeline failure tonight, it's almost certainly a genuine new finding, not baseline drift. Don't regenerate without a review. The analyzer currently runs with these settings:

settings of tagef-bawif:
DRUIX_HOST=druix.zemvarlabs.internal
DRUIX_PORT=8000

## Deploying the Gatewick Proctor Queue

Deploys are pretty painless: push to main, wait for the pipeline, then watch the queue drain dashboard for five minutes. If candidates pile up mid-exam, roll back first and ask questions later — the queue replays safely. Everything the workers care about lives in one config block, shown here for reference.

settings of bafof-yagef:
JOROX_PIN=8740
JOROX_TENANT=pelox
JOROX_METRICS_HOST=metrics.jorox.qorvelworks.internal
JOROX_SEAL=seal_c78f63c1
JOROX_STANDBY_TEAM=norax